Oracle中求取两数的差值(oracle中求差)
Oracle中求取两数的差值
在Oracle数据库中,我们经常需要求取各种数据的差值以便进行数据分析和数据处理。求取两数的差值是其中一种常见的操作。下面,我将介绍在Oracle中如何求取两数的差值。
求取两数差值的语法
Oracle数据库中,我们可以使用以下语句来求取两数的差值:
select number1 - number2 as difference from table_name;
其中,number1和number2是要求差值的两个数字,table_name是包含这两个数字的表名,difference是计算结果的列名。
示例代码
为了更好地说明这一语句,我们可以使用一个简单的示例。假设我们有如下一个表,名为users:
| id | name | age |
|——|——–|——-|
| 1 | Tom | 25 |
| 2 | Jack | 30 |
| 3 | Mike | 28 |
我们可以使用以下语句,求取Tom和Jack年龄的差值:
select age as difference from users where name = 'Tom'
minusselect age as difference from users where name = 'Jack';
这个语句的执行结果为:
| difference |
|————–|
| -5 |
在这个例子中,我们使用了minus运算符来求取Tom和Jack的年龄差值。
除了minus外,我们还可以使用其他运算符来求取两个数的差值,比如+、*和/等。
结语
以上介绍了在Oracle中求取两数的差值的语法和示例代码。在实际工作中,我们需要根据具体场景选择合适的运算符和方法来求取差值。